Once you have chosen a server, you need to decide what content you would like to put up. Most people begin with their surnames and build from there. One thing that you should remember is to make sure that you don't infringe upon someone else's copyrights. Always give credit to those who deserve it.

You probably have an idea of what you want to put up on your site. While you are in the process of putting your site up, make sure that you are organizing it in a logical way. There are two ways in which you can organize your website.
  • Sequential: in this way, you will organize your site pretty much the same way that you would read a book. In other words, on each of the pages, you would want to link to the page before and after the one that you are currently on.
  • Heirarchal: in this way, you would organize your site, with one main page to refer to. Many people have a sitemap for their visitors to keep referring to. This seems to be the preferred way for genealogists, because genealogy sites can become quite large.
If you are still not sure on a way to set up your site, then go and visit other genealogy websites and see how they are set up. By getting an idea of how others did theirs, you will come up with a way that you want to do yours.

Once you get your site set up and running, the next step is to promote it. One way that you can do this is to submit your site to all the search engines. By doing this, you will be listed when someone searches for genealogy sites. Another good way to promote your site is to add your link in your signature that you use when you email your friends. However you chose to promote your site, just remember to get your name out there!
